## Recovery — Parceline Webhook Account

If the Parceline webhook service account locks after repeated signature failures, your plugin deliveries stop. Do not retry; retries extend the lockout. File a notice in the plugin forum, then an operator runs the unlock tool against the dispatch node. The tool requires the service account's recovery passphrase, listed below.

unlock words, yawig-kagef: gordor-holvan-ulaael-pramir-ulaiel-tamdor

## Onboarding: Farebranch Rules Engine

Plugin authors integrate with Farebranch by registering fee rules against the evaluation API. Rules are sandboxed; they cannot perform network calls directly. All rate-table lookups go through the host, which validates your plugin manifest at load time. Your local env file must include the signing credential the host uses to verify manifests, set on the next line.

secret setting of bajef-fajof: COURIER_KEY3=76c

MEMO — Sales Leads

The Q4 budget request for the Norbeck territory expansion is now with finance. We asked for 120k: headcount for two field reps, the Tallis demo van, and event fees for the Greyharbour expo. Expect a decision within ten days. Hold discretionary spend until then. Do not discuss the expansion with Renlow accounts yet. The reasoning behind this restriction is set out below.

management briefing: Jorixax Holdings is in early talks to buy Casixax Holdings for about $420.3 million. The Fenmir launch date is October 27, and nothing goes to the press before then. Legal wants the Keloxek Foods term sheet redrafted before April 16.

TURN-208: Gatevale turnstile counters at the Merrow Field pilot double-count when a rotation reverses mid-cycle. Attendance totals drift roughly 2% high per event. The debounce window fix is implemented, reviewed by Ilsa, and soak-tested across two simulated match days without drift. Ready for your cut; the candidate build is identified below.

trace token, tagag-tafog: htk6_5ed18c

Handover: Exportron retry queue

Hi Mira — handing over the failed-export retries. Exports that hit a timeout land in the retry queue and get three attempts with backoff; after that they're parked and need a manual requeue from the admin panel. Watch for customers reporting duplicates — that usually means a double requeue. The current retry settings are as follows.

settings of bajog-fawig:
oliael:
  log_level: warn
  metrics_host: metrics.oliael.zemvarsys.internal
  pin: 0267
  pool_size: 32